St. Germain Elderflower Liquer
My brother had a St. Germain cocktail in NYC and duplicated it at home. It's called the Grapes of Wrath. His recipe:
3 Kirkland brand vodka
1 St. Germain
1 apple juice
1 sauvignon blanc
Shake over ice and pour into cocktail glass. Add 1 or 2 frozen red grapes. Yum!

Ham Salad Recipe
My husband's family has a recipe for ham salad that I've tried to duplicate with pretty good results. Their recipe is very imprecise but what I do is put the leftover ham in the food processor and chop it up a bit then add a small jar of drained green olives, onion, a few hard boiled eggs, freshly ground black pepper, and mayo. Process that till it's the desired texture then stir in some cubed cheddar cheese. Fill sandwich rolls with this mixture, wrap in foil and bake in the oven till hot. My family loves these sandwiches.

BEST tres leches?
This is the one my Peruvian daughter-in-law makes. It's wonderful, and even better the next day.
Pastel de Tres Leches
This version makes 10 generous portions.
CAKE:
1 cup sugar
5 large eggs, separated
1/3 cup milk
1/2 tsp vanilla extract
1 cup all-purpose flour
1-1/2 tsp baking powder
1/2 tsp cream of tartar
MILK SYRUP:
1 can (12 oz) evaporated milk
1 cup sweetened condensed milk
1 cup heavy (or whipping) cream
1 tsp vanilla extract
1 Tbsp dark rum
GARNISHES:
Fresh whipped cream or good quality vanilla ice cream
Cocoa powder
Sliced fresh mango (or the fruit of your choice- tropical fruits pair nicely with this cake)
METHOD:
Preheat oven to 350oF. Generously butter a 13 x 9-inch baking dish.CAKE: Beat 3/4 cup sugar and the egg yolks until light and fluffy, about 5 minutes. Fold in the milk, vanilla, flour and baking powder.Beat the egg whites to soft peaks, adding the cream of tartar after 20 seconds. Gradually add the remaining 1/4 cup sugar and continue beating until the whites are glossy and firm, but not dry. Gently fold the whites into the yolk mixture. Pour this batter into the buttered baking dish.Bake the cake until it feels firm and an inserted toothpick comes out clean, about 30-45 minutes. Let the cake cool completely in baking dish. Pierce the cake all over with a fork, taking care to not tear it up.
MILK SYRUP: Combine the evaporated milk, sweetened condensed milk, cream, vanilla and rum in a mixing bowl. Whisk until well blended. Pour the syrup over the cake, spooning the overflow back on top, until it is all absorbed.
When ready to serve, cut a slice and plate it. Top with a dollop of freshly whipped cream or a side of ice cream, dust cake and cream with some fresh cocoa powder and place a slice or two of fresh mango on the side. This cake is addictive- you've been warned! Enjoy!
